====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E RAJENDRA KUMAR MISHRA ORAL ORDER ---------- 22-12-2016 Heard learned counsel for the petitioners and the learned A.P.P. for the State.
The petitioners apprehend their arrest in connection with Mahmadpur P.S. Case No.87 of 2016 registered under Sections 341, 323, 324, 307 and 504/34 of the Indian Penal Code. The accusation of the informant is that on 13.08.2016 at about 08.30 P.M. in the night when she alongwith her sister-inlaw Sangita Kumari had gone outside of the house to attend the call of nature, then Lalita Devi, the wife of the petitioner no.1 flashed torchlight on her. When she made protest, Lalita Devi while abusing started to run to cause assault to her and her sister-
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.54988 of 2016 (2) dt.22-12-2016 2/3 in-law. Thereafter, the informant and her sister-in-law moved from there and came to her house. At that time, Lalita Devi alongwith her husband Satyendra Rai (petitioner no.1), Pappu Rai (petitioner no.2) and others entered the house of the informant and started to abuse and cause assault to the informant and her sister-in-aw. In that course, Lalita Devi caused injury at the head of the informant through Daab. On alarm being raised by the informant rushed there, then all fled away from the house of the informant.
Learned counsel appearing on behalf of the petitioners submits that, in fact, the petitioners and the informant are next door neighbours and due to some dispute, the alleged occurrence took place in which the informant fell down on the earth and sustained injury, which is said to be caused by Lalita Devi, the wife of the petitioner no.1. Further submission is that while it is alleged that the petitioners were present at the house of the informant at the time of the alleged occurrence but no specific overt act is attributed to the petitioners. Moreover, the injuries, as found on the person of the informant, are of simple in nature caused by hard and blunt substance.
Having considered the facts and the circumstances of the case, let the petitioners, above named, in the event of their arrest or surrender by them within six weeks from today, be enlarged on
